Witryna26 kwi 2024 · The Battle of Beaver Dams was fought on 24 th June 1813, at the time of the Anglo American War of 1812. The battle broke out after Laura Secord delivered a warning of an American effort to attack a British colony at Beaver Dams, Fort George. WitrynaThe War of 1812 has been called “America’s Forgotten War.” It is studied much less than the American Revolution or the Civil War, as a result, many of its battlefields are ignored for development. In 2007 the National Parks Service identified 214 battlefields and other important sites to the War of 1812. What 3 things started the War of 1812? Witryna1 lip 2024 · Why were the Great Lakes so important in the War of 1812? Even more important, for a military context at least, the lakes provide the most convenient supply route between America and Canada.
